mirror of
https://git.savannah.gnu.org/git/guile.git
synced 2025-06-06 04:00:26 +02:00
New collector configuration: generational-pcc
This commit is contained in:
parent
65b74b5abb
commit
c95b7ef046
1 changed files with 9 additions and 3 deletions
6
Makefile
6
Makefile
|
@ -2,7 +2,9 @@ TESTS = quads mt-gcbench ephemerons finalizers
|
||||||
COLLECTORS = \
|
COLLECTORS = \
|
||||||
bdw \
|
bdw \
|
||||||
semi \
|
semi \
|
||||||
|
\
|
||||||
pcc \
|
pcc \
|
||||||
|
generational-pcc \
|
||||||
\
|
\
|
||||||
mmc \
|
mmc \
|
||||||
stack-conservative-mmc \
|
stack-conservative-mmc \
|
||||||
|
@ -68,6 +70,10 @@ GC_STEM_pcc = pcc
|
||||||
GC_CFLAGS_pcc = -DGC_PRECISE_ROOTS=1 -DGC_PARALLEL=1
|
GC_CFLAGS_pcc = -DGC_PRECISE_ROOTS=1 -DGC_PARALLEL=1
|
||||||
GC_LIBS_pcc = -lm
|
GC_LIBS_pcc = -lm
|
||||||
|
|
||||||
|
GC_STEM_generational_pcc = $(GC_STEM_pcc)
|
||||||
|
GC_CFLAGS_generational_pcc = $(GC_CFLAGS_pcc) -DGC_GENERATIONAL=1
|
||||||
|
GC_LIBS_generational_pcc = $(GC_LIBS_pcc)
|
||||||
|
|
||||||
define mmc_variant
|
define mmc_variant
|
||||||
GC_STEM_$(1) = mmc
|
GC_STEM_$(1) = mmc
|
||||||
GC_CFLAGS_$(1) = $(2)
|
GC_CFLAGS_$(1) = $(2)
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ue